As a Guest Service Agent at Hilton, you play a pivotal role in creating memorable experiences for every guest from the moment they arrive until their departure. This role is not just about the usual check-in and check-out procedures; it is about delivering genuine hospitality that brightens someone's day. You will engage with guests warmly, assisting them through the check-in process by verifying their details, assigning rooms, issuing keys, and ensuring they receive all necessary welcome information. Throughout their stay, you are the first point of contact, providing valuable hotel and local area knowledge, responding promptly to requests, resolving concerns, and managing communications with care and urgency.

Job Duties

  • Deliver a warm welcome to guests by greeting and completing the check-in process including verifying details, assigning rooms, issuing keys, and providing welcome materials or bell service assistance
  • Support efficient check-out by processing guest departures including verifying charges, handling payments, issuing receipts, and accurately using the point-of-sale system
  • Provide comprehensive hotel and local knowledge to assist with guest inquiries including room types, rates, promotions, and local area information
  • Promote hotel services using up-selling techniques to recommend amenities and maximize room and service revenue
  • Respond promptly and effectively to guest requests and concerns, managing messages and communications with care and urgency
